HONG KONG (China Daily/ANN): The number of unemployed persons in Hong Kong more than doubled in the third quarter when compared during the same period last year, according to a government survey.
According to the Quarterly Report on General Household Survey released on Monday (Nov 30) afternoon, the number of unemployed reached 259,800 in Q3 compared to 120,000 during the same period in 2019. The figure is also higher than the 240,700 recorded in the second quarter of this year.
